Statute of limitations

For most types of personal injury the statute of limitations starts in the moment that the incident occurs. However, latest asbestos litigation cases are different. For instance, it could take years between asbestos exposure and diagnosis because of the long latency time. Suits of different types

If an asbestos exposure victim files a lawsuit, it may be based on the basis of personal injury or on the basis of wrongful death. In both instances, the victim faces an asbestos company to recover compensation for their condition.

Asbestos sufferers typically have their cases filed at the state level instead of in the federal court system. This is because the law favors plaintiffs. When a lawsuit is filed, defendants receive copies of the complaint. They are given a specific time frame to respond. The defendants typically deny the claims in their response and argue that someone else is to blame for the asbestos exposure.

Evidence

The victim must have suffered an injury due to asbestos exposure. This could include asbestosis mesothelioma, lung cancer and mesothelioma. Victims of injuries can be awarded compensation for economic and noneconomic damages. Economic damages include past and future medical costs, lost income, lost earning potential, as well as other costs related to their injuries. Noneconomic damages include emotional distress along with pain and suffering as well as loss of enjoyment of life.

Asbestos litigation may also involve multiple companies that are liable for the harm suffered by victims. Many of the companies that produced asbestos-containing products filed for bankruptcy proceedings, where trust funds were created for present and future claimants who had been harmed by their products.

In the majority of cases, plaintiffs who bring the lawsuit against the businesses are seeking strict liability and negligence. The plaintiffs claim that asbestos-containing companies did not exercise reasonable care in manufacturing, selling and using their products. This includes not informing workers about the dangers of asbestos and not putting in place appropriate safety measures in place.

Trial

Each asbestos claim is distinct and requires a specific proof. There are some elements that are common to all cases. A plaintiff, for instance must be able to demonstrate that they were exposed to asbestos and that exposure led to their illness or injury. A successful lawsuit will also compensate victims for past and future losses. This includes medical costs loss of income, pain and discomfort.

A mesothelioma attorney can help victims create an argument that is strong enough to get compensation. The first step is to file a claim in the appropriate court. The complaint outlines the situation and What is Asbestos Litigation alleges the defendants were negligent in exposed asbestos to people. After this the legal process of discovery starts. This includes interrogatories, depositions, and requests for documents. In this phase attorneys will collect as much evidence possible. After this stage, the attorneys will prepare for the possibility of a trial or settlement negotiations.
